The question whether persecuted women can be refugees seems uncontroversial and now well-settled as a matter of international refugee law. Yet, closer scrutiny of case law suggests that there are multiple impediments to the recognition of women’s asylum claims. In this paper, the author presents three emerging trends in the jurisprudence of a number of countries, which have an impact on the recognition of gender-related asylum claims. The author calls these trends – distinction, discretion and discrimination – the “new frontiers” to gender-related claims.
